Abstract
A backshell, the backshell including a first shell member having a first end, a second end and a first channel, a second shell member having a first end, a second end and a second channel, the second shell member being configured to interface with the first shell member so that, when interfaced, the first ends of the first and second shell members are adjacent each other and defines a backshell first end, the second ends of the first and second shell members are adjacent each other and defines a backshell second end, and the channels of the first and the second shell members form a wire bundle passage extending between the backshell first end and the backshell second end, and a coupling ring configured to engage both the first shell member and the second shell member at the backshell first end to couple the first shell member to the second shell member.
